Online Check In Alamo
Hi
I have booked through a TA for our flight and car, ive had the paperwork and tried to do skip the counter. It didn't work, the TA says its part of Alamos policy that you cant skip the counter through a third party booking? Is this right? I have a reference number but no barcode? thanks |

I'm tied up this evening - not literally!
However it's the usual TA crap we see all the time. All bookings no matter who they have been made by are capable of doing OLCI and skip the counter.

We booked Alamo through uscarhire.com and have done skip the counter for our November trip.
We did an online check in on the Alamo site using uscarhire confirmation number.

Just to add that the bar code is the end of the process. It's what you get after you've done OLCI/STC which are basically the same thing. I always do it via Alamo Brits or DFCH where you simply stay on the web site and do it in a couple of clicks. This is the form that I fill in though - worth a try. I should say though that the "confirmation number" I use is an Alamo one. alamo/en_US/car-rental/checkin.html Mick
